Reprogramming a car key typically costs $50-$250 for programming alone and $70-$500 or more when the replacement key or fob is included. Basic transponder keys are usually least expensive, while push-button-start proximity keys, lost-all-key situations, luxury vehicles, emergency callouts, and dealership security access create the highest bills.

How Much Does It Cost to Reprogram a Car Key?
Car key reprogramming alone generally costs $50-$250, but a complete replacement usually costs more because the invoice can include the key, cutting, programming, mobile travel, emergency labor, and security-code access. Typical US consumer pricing is shown below; metropolitan rates and luxury-brand pricing can exceed these ranges.
| Key or service type | Programming-only price | Typical total with replacement key | Typical appointment time |
|---|---|---|---|
| Metal key with no chip | $0-$30 | $20-$80 | 10-20 minutes |
| Transponder ignition key | $50-$100 | $70-$150 | 15-30 minutes |
| Remote-head key | $60-$140 | $100-$250 | 20-40 minutes |
| Separate remote fob | $50-$120 | $90-$220 | 15-35 minutes |
| Push-button proximity fob | $100-$250 | $200-$500+ | 30-60 minutes |
| All keys lost, standard vehicle | $100-$250 | $180-$450 | 45-120 minutes |
| Luxury or restricted-security vehicle | $150-$400 | $400-$800+ | 60-180 minutes |
The most important pricing distinction is programming versus replacement. If a vehicle owner already has a compatible, cut key or blank fob, the technician may charge only for synchronization. If the key is missing, the bill also covers the replacement device and, for an all-keys-lost job, additional vehicle-security work.
After-hours appointments can add $50-$150, while a mobile locksmith may add a travel or service-call charge of $20-$100. Dealers often bundle diagnosis, OEM parts, and programming into one labor line, making their quote harder to compare directly with a locksmith’s programming-only price.
What Does a Car Key Need to Be Programmed?
A car key needs a compatible transponder or electronic fob, a vehicle immobilizer system, and a programming method authorized for that make, model, year, and market. A cut metal blade alone does not require electronic programming, but a chip key or proximity fob does if it must start the vehicle.
A modern automotive key may contain several separate functions:
- Mechanical blade: Opens the door or turns an ignition cylinder.
- Transponder chip: Communicates with the immobilizer for engine authorization.
- Remote transmitter: Operates lock, unlock, trunk, or panic buttons.
- Proximity system: Lets the vehicle detect a fob inside or near the cabin.
- Emergency blade: Provides physical entry when the fob battery is dead.
These functions do not always use the same programming procedure. A remote may lock and unlock the doors while its immobilizer function remains unregistered. Conversely, a transponder may start the engine while the remote buttons remain inactive.
The vehicle’s immobilizer control module, body control module, instrument cluster, or engine-control system stores authorized identifiers. The exact architecture varies by manufacturer. Some cars use a separate immobilizer module, while others integrate authorization into a body or gateway module.
How Does Car Key Programming Work?
Car key programming creates an authorized relationship between the vehicle’s security module and the key’s electronic identifier. During programming, a diagnostic tool or approved vehicle procedure places the car into a learn mode, authenticates access, and stores the new key data.
A simplified sequence is:
- The technician identifies the vehicle and compatible key.
- The vehicle enters a security-authorized learning mode.
- The key and vehicle exchange encrypted or coded information.
- The immobilizer stores the key identifier.
- The technician tests starting, locking, proximity detection, and emergency functions.
The common description of an ECU sending a pulse and the key returning a code is directionally useful, but it is not a complete description of every vehicle. Some systems use low-frequency wake-up antennas, radio-frequency responses, rolling codes, cryptographic authentication, challenge-response exchanges, or security gateways between the diagnostic port and immobilizer module.
A key-fob battery usually powers the buttons and proximity transmitter. The passive transponder used for starting may operate through the vehicle’s inductive field on some designs, meaning a weak fob battery can disable remote entry without preventing an emergency start. The owner’s manual determines the correct backup-start position.
Which Car Key Type Costs the Least?
A traditional transponder key costs the least among electronically coded keys because it normally contains a small chip and a mechanical blade rather than a proximity module, multiple antennas, or a complex remote circuit board. A simple replacement commonly totals $70-$150 when a compatible blank is available.
| Key type | Main vehicle function | Common failure symptom | Typical replacement total |
|---|---|---|---|
| Metal key | Physical entry or ignition rotation | Key turns lock but has no electronic function | $20-$80 |
| Transponder key | Engine-start authorization | Engine cranks or turns over but will not run | $70-$150 |
| Remote-head key | Starting plus remote buttons | Start works, buttons fail, or both functions fail | $100-$250 |
| Smart proximity fob | Keyless entry and push-button start | “No key detected” or intermittent entry | $200-$500+ |
| Integrated digital key | Phone or card-based authorization | App, phone, or vehicle pairing failure | $0-$300, vehicle dependent |
Older vehicles sometimes support owner programming when two already-authorized keys are available. That capability is manufacturer-specific and cannot be inferred from the key’s appearance. The vehicle owner’s manual is more reliable than a generic online sequence.
Is Programming a Remote Fob the Same as Programming a Transponder?
Programming a remote fob is not necessarily the same as programming a transponder key. Remote programming controls wireless convenience features such as door locks, whereas transponder programming authorizes the vehicle’s immobilizer to permit engine operation.
This distinction explains many confusing outcomes:
- The remote buttons work, but the engine will not start.
- The engine starts, but the door-lock buttons do nothing.
- A replacement shell fits the blade but contains an incompatible chip.
- A fob battery replacement restores buttons but does not repair lost immobilizer authorization.
- A vehicle accepts a remote through a manual sequence but requires a scan tool for the immobilizer.
Some vehicles combine these procedures into one diagnostic session. Others separate them completely. A quote should state whether it includes remote synchronization, immobilizer registration, key cutting, or all three.
Can You Program a Car Key Yourself?
You can program some car keys yourself, but only when the vehicle manufacturer provides an owner procedure and the required prerequisites are present. The most common prerequisite is two already-working keys, although some models permit a single-key procedure or remote-only programming.
A generic two-key sequence may resemble this pattern:
- Insert an authorized key and switch the ignition to the specified position.
- Turn it off within the manufacturer’s time limit.
- Insert the second authorized key and repeat the sequence.
- Insert the new key and place the ignition in the required position.
- Wait for the security indicator or confirmation message.
- Test engine starting and remote functions.
That sequence is not universal. Timing, ignition position, door state, key order, and the number of keys required vary by make and model. Applying the wrong sequence normally fails, but repeated incorrect attempts can trigger a security lockout or consume a limited learning cycle.
DIY programming is most reasonable when the owner has a verified blank, two working keys, a stable vehicle battery, and an exact factory procedure. It is a poor choice when all keys are lost, the vehicle has a security gateway, the replacement fob is used, or the vehicle is needed immediately.
What Happens During Professional OBD-II Programming?
Professional OBD-II programming connects a compatible diagnostic tool to the vehicle’s data network and uses authorized software to add, delete, or synchronize keys. The technician first verifies ownership and vehicle identity, then performs a security procedure specific to the manufacturer.
A legitimate professional process generally includes:
- Confirming the VIN, model year, key type, and replacement part.
- Checking vehicle and key-fob battery voltage.
- Connecting an automotive diagnostic programmer to the data port.
- Obtaining security access through a PIN, online account, token, or timed procedure.
- Adding the new key and confirming whether existing keys remain enrolled.
- Testing immobilizer authorization, remote operation, proximity detection, and emergency functions.
The phrase “OBD programming” does not describe one universal tool or one universal level of access. Some vehicles allow local key addition, while others require manufacturer-server authentication, a subscription, a security gateway unlock, or an approved OEM platform.
A technician may erase missing keys from memory during an all-keys-lost job, but key deletion is not automatic on every vehicle. Ask directly: Will my existing keys still work after this procedure? Bring every working key to the appointment because some systems require all keys to be present during relearning.
Which Service Is Cheaper, a Locksmith or a Dealership?
An automotive locksmith is usually cheaper for compatible transponder and proximity-key work, often charging 30%-50% less than a dealer, while a dealership is more likely to handle restricted security systems and OEM-only parts. The better option depends on the vehicle, location, key availability, and whether all keys are missing.
| Decision factor | Mobile automotive locksmith | Dealership service department | DIY kit or online purchase |
|---|---|---|---|
| Typical total, standard transponder | $70-$180 | $150-$350 | $30-$120 |
| Typical total, proximity fob | $200-$500 | $350-$800+ | $100-$350 |
| Vehicle access | Mobile, often 20-60 minutes away | Usually requires appointment or towing | Owner must access vehicle |
| Key source | OEM or aftermarket, application dependent | Usually OEM | Aftermarket or online seller |
| All-keys-lost capability | Common on supported models | Common, model dependent | Limited and risky |
| Security access | Multi-brand tools and credentials | Factory systems and databases | Model-specific, often restricted |
| Best fit | Standard vehicles and roadside situations | Restricted, newer, or warranty work | Supported older vehicles with two keys |
A locksmith may not be the right choice for every car. Some newer European vehicles require online credentials, a security gateway procedure, or a manufacturer-only key authorization process. A dealer may also be preferable when the vehicle remains under a key-system warranty or when an OEM replacement is required for an insurance claim.
Dealership towing is not inevitable. Some dealers offer mobile or roadside programming, and some locksmiths cannot program a vehicle without bringing it to a shop. Confirm the access requirement before accepting the quote.
Why Does an All-Keys-Lost Job Cost More?
An all-keys-lost job costs more because the technician must create a new authorized key without relying on an existing key’s authorization, and may need to secure the vehicle against the missing key. The typical total is $180-$450 for standard vehicles and $400-$800 or more for restricted luxury models.
The additional work may include:
- Traveling to a locked or stranded vehicle.
- Identifying the VIN when no key is available.
- Producing or cutting a mechanical blade.
- Extracting security data or completing an online authorization.
- Adding the new key to the immobilizer.
- Deleting missing keys where the vehicle supports that function.
- Testing whether the new key starts and operates the vehicle.
Deleting a lost key from memory does not recover the physical key or guarantee that every control module has removed it. Ask the technician whether the lost identifier is being removed from the immobilizer, remote system, passive-entry system, or all relevant modules.
Vehicle ownership verification is normal. A locksmith or dealer may request government identification, registration, title, insurance documents, or a lease agreement. This protects against unauthorized key creation.
Are Used Car Key Fobs Programmable?
Used car key fobs are programmable on some vehicles but permanently locked or economically impractical on others. Compatibility depends on the exact part number, FCC ID, frequency, transponder type, immobilizer generation, and whether the fob has already been paired to another vehicle.
| Compatibility check | Example information | Why it matters |
|---|---|---|
| Vehicle identity | 2020 Toyota RAV4 XLE | Trim and year can change key application |
| Part number | 89904-0R180 | Identifies the intended electronic assembly |
| FCC ID | HYQ14FBA | Confirms transmitter certification and application |
| Frequency | 315 MHz or 433 MHz | Region and model determine radio operation |
| Key condition | New, refurbished, previously paired | Some modules cannot be reset economically |
| Blade format | Emergency blade profile | Determines physical entry compatibility |
An online listing that says “fits Toyota” or “fits Ford” is insufficient. The replacement must match the vehicle’s application, and a visually identical shell can contain the wrong circuit board or frequency.
The blanket claim that every used proximity fob is unusable is inaccurate. Some brands and generations permit reset or reuse with specialized equipment; others retain vehicle-specific data or require a new OEM unit. A locksmith can often determine reusability before attempting programming.
What Mistakes Make Programming Fail?
The most common programming failures involve an incompatible key, low voltage, incomplete key enrollment, incorrect security access, or a damaged vehicle antenna. The programming fee may still apply because the technician has spent time diagnosing a compatibility or vehicle fault rather than simply adding a key.
Avoid these mistakes:
- Matching appearance instead of identifiers. Verify part number, FCC ID, frequency, chip type, and VIN application.
- Ignoring vehicle-battery voltage. A weak battery can interrupt a security procedure; stabilize voltage before programming.
- Bringing only one working key. Some vehicles erase or require re-enrollment of all keys during the session.
- Confusing a dead fob battery with lost programming. Replace the correct coin cell before ordering a new fob.
- Using an uncut emergency blade. Electronic registration does not make a blade mechanically fit the locks.
- Starting with a cheap universal tool. Unsupported security functions can leave the vehicle unable to accept additional keys.
A practitioner rule of thumb is to verify the replacement part before paying for programming. A technician can often reject the wrong fob in minutes, while an attempted session may create additional diagnostic work or a temporary security lockout.
What Should You Check When a Programmed Key Does Not Work?
When a programmed key does not work, check the fob battery, vehicle battery, key compatibility, security indicator, and emergency-start procedure before assuming the programming failed. Remote buttons, passive entry, and engine authorization should be tested separately because each can fail independently.
Use this diagnostic order:
- Install the specified CR2032, CR2025, or other correct battery with the polarity facing the marked direction.
- Test the vehicle battery, especially if interior lights are dim or the starter operates slowly.
- Try the emergency key blade for physical entry.
- Hold the fob in the manufacturer-specified backup-start position.
- Observe the immobilizer or padlock indicator.
- Test the original key, if available, to separate a vehicle fault from a replacement-key fault.
- Confirm that the key’s FCC ID, frequency, and part number match the vehicle.
A rapidly flashing security light may indicate an unrecognized or unauthorized key, but dashboard symbols vary by manufacturer. A failed antenna, damaged ignition reader, blown fuse, or body-control-module fault can mimic a programming problem.
A nonworking remote does not necessarily mean the immobilizer key is bad. If the engine starts normally but the buttons fail, diagnose the remote circuit and battery first.
How Can You Reduce the Programming Price?
You can reduce the programming price by obtaining a precise compatible key, using a mobile locksmith during normal hours, bringing every working key, and comparing a written locksmith quote with the dealer’s complete price. The cheapest online fob is not the cheapest solution if it cannot be reset or programmed.
Before requesting a quote, record:
- Vehicle make, model, year, and trim.
- VIN, if the provider requests it securely.
- Turn-key ignition or push-button start.
- Number of working keys.
- Whether the key starts the engine.
- Whether remote buttons or proximity entry work.
- Whether a blade must be cut.
- Your location and whether the vehicle is accessible.
Ask for these invoice details:
- Replacement key or fob price.
- Cutting price.
- Immobilizer programming fee.
- Remote synchronization fee.
- Mobile callout or after-hours charge.
- Security-code or online-access charge.
- Warranty period.
- Whether existing keys remain active.
Insurance, roadside-assistance memberships, vehicle warranties, fleet programs, and some lease agreements may reimburse key replacement. Coverage commonly depends on proof of ownership, an itemized invoice, and whether the loss resulted from theft, accidental damage, or simple misplacement.
How Long Does Car Key Programming Take?
Car key programming usually takes 15-60 minutes when the correct key and a working vehicle are available. All-keys-lost jobs, security-gateway vehicles, damaged locks, online authorization, or luxury European systems can take 45-180 minutes.
| Situation | Typical programming time | Main delay |
|---|---|---|
| Remote-only synchronization | 10-30 minutes | Vehicle-specific entry sequence |
| Spare transponder key | 15-30 minutes | Security access or cutting |
| New proximity fob | 30-60 minutes | Authentication and multi-system testing |
| All keys lost, standard model | 45-120 minutes | Key creation and deletion procedure |
| Newer European vehicle | 60-180 minutes | Online credentials or gateway access |
| Damaged ignition or antenna | 1-4 hours | Diagnosis and component repair |
Programming time is separate from travel time and waiting for a replacement part. A dealer may quote a short labor time but require an appointment several days later, while a mobile locksmith may arrive quickly but need to source an uncommon OEM fob.
Which Option Fits Your Situation?
The best option depends on the vehicle’s security level and the number of working keys, not simply on the lowest advertised programming fee.
You Have Two Working Keys
Use the manufacturer’s owner procedure if the manual confirms self-programming and the new key is verified compatible. Expected cost can be $20-$100 for a blank or fob, although some vehicles still require a professional scan tool.
You Have One Working Key
A locksmith is usually the practical choice. The appointment commonly costs $70-$250, and bringing the existing key helps the technician confirm the vehicle’s system before adding another.
You Have No Working Keys
Request an all-keys-lost quote from a locksmith experienced with the exact vehicle. Expect $180-$450 for many standard vehicles, with higher prices for restricted models, towing, emergency service, or key deletion.
You Drive a New European Luxury Vehicle
Call a dealer or a locksmith that explicitly lists the exact model and security generation. Confirm online authorization, OEM-key availability, security-gateway access, and whether the provider can complete the job without towing.
You Only Need a Replacement Fob Battery
Do not pay for immobilizer programming before installing the correct battery and testing the backup-start procedure. A battery replacement commonly costs $5-$20 for the cell, or approximately $20-$60 when a shop supplies and installs it.
What Information Produces an Accurate Quote?
An accurate car-key quote requires the vehicle’s make, model, year, trim, ignition type, working-key count, and exact symptom. “I need a key for a 2018 Ford” is not enough because different trims and markets can use different key systems.
A provider should be able to explain whether the quoted price covers a blank key, OEM or aftermarket hardware, blade cutting, immobilizer registration, remote programming, mobile labor, taxes, and a workmanship warranty. A quote that lists only “programming” may exclude the most expensive component, the replacement fob.
The strongest expert practice is to request two prices: programming an owner-supplied verified key and supplying and programming the complete replacement. The difference reveals whether online purchasing actually saves money.

Can AutoZone or another parts store program my car key?
Some parts stores can cut metal keys, replace fob batteries, or program selected remote transmitters, but coverage varies by vehicle and store equipment. Many immobilizer transponder and proximity-key systems require a locksmith or dealer with dedicated diagnostic access. Call the specific location with the VIN application and key part number before purchasing a blank.
Does a new car key have to be cut before programming?
A mechanical blade should be cut before the complete key is tested, but electronic programming and blade cutting are separate operations. A correctly programmed transponder can authorize engine starting even if its emergency blade is uncut, while an uncut blade cannot reliably open the door or operate a mechanical ignition cylinder.
Can a dead key-fob battery prevent the car from starting?
A dead fob battery can prevent remote locking and passive-entry detection, but many vehicles still permit emergency starting through a designated backup position. The exact position may be a steering-column slot, center-console pocket, cupholder, or start-button contact point. The owner’s manual identifies the correct location.
Will programming a new key erase my old key?
Programming a new key does not always erase an old key, but some vehicle procedures erase the key list and require every desired key to be present. Ask the technician whether the job is an add-key procedure or an all-keys-relearn procedure, then bring every working key to avoid an unexpected inactive spare.
Is a dealership always safer than a locksmith?
A dealership is not always the only safe option, and a qualified automotive locksmith can program many standard vehicles with appropriate equipment and ownership verification. Dealerships are usually stronger for restricted OEM systems, current European security platforms, and warranty documentation. Confirm exact model capability rather than choosing solely by business type.
Does roadside assistance pay for car-key programming?
Roadside assistance may cover lockout entry or towing but often excludes the replacement key and electronic programming. Policy terms differ by insurer and membership plan. Before authorizing work, ask whether the benefit covers mobile locksmith labor, the key itself, after-hours charges, and a maximum reimbursement amount.
